Incentives for
exports lauded
ISLAMABAD: Shahid Rashid Butt, former President of Islamabad Chamber of Commerce & Industry (ICCI) and Chairman Founder Group on Thursday lauded the incentives provided by the government to the exporters and called for making all out efforts for boosting country's exports.
He was addressing a seminar at the Pakistan National Centre, Islamabad, on "promotion of exports and its importance to Pakistan's economy".
Shahid Rashid Butt, said that government has granted adequate incentives such as export finance facility, duty free import of raw materials for exportable goods and simplification of payment of rebates through the banking system. The businessmen should avail these facilities and make earnest efforts to increase production.
The seminar was chaired by Habibullah, Chairman of Export Promotion Bureau, and attended by a large number of businessmen, exporters, and government functionaries who exchanged views about the importance of increasing exports for Pakistan's economic development.
Butt urged the Pakistani exporters to make optimum use of the incentives and opportunities offered for promoting bilateral trade.
Shahid Butt said Islamabad Chamber is in the process of establishing a Display Centre of exportable products and urged the Export Promotion Bureau to provide financial and technical support to the chamber for this project. -APP
